Verdict

CAP DU NORD came of age over fences last season, winning a valuable handicap at Newbury on his second start before a series of fine runs in defeat in other good races. Last month's spin at Chepstow should have blown the cobwebs away and a big effort could be forthcoming with his usual cheekpieces back on. Highland Hunter is a huge player for Paul Nicholls, as is last year's winner El Presente.
